A leader of the Uddhav Thackeray faction of the Shiv Sena on July 16 said that the Eknath Shinde government in Maharashtra wanted to prolong the process of renaming Aurangabad.

While the Maha Vikas Aghadi government under Uddhav Thackeray had decided to rename the city Sambhajinagar in its last Cabinet meeting on June 29, the new dispensation on Saturday passed a new proposal that sees the largest city of Marathwada named ”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ar”.

In a press conference, Maharashtra Legislative Council member Ambadas Danve, who is part of the Thackeray group in the Shiv Sena, said that the addition to the name would require more and fresh looks from the Center and these would take time. .

“The process to get nods had started in 2020 under the MVA government. If the name is now approved again as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ar, then all permissions will have to be obtained again. This will prolong the nomination process, which seems to be the intention of the Eknath Shinde government,” said Mr. Danve.
